DeepSeek MathProver:开源数学证明的革命性突破
2025.09.25 19:44浏览量:0简介:DeepSeek发布全球首个支持全流程自动化定理证明的开源模型MathProver,其证明效率较传统方法提升3-5倍,覆盖从初等代数到高阶拓扑学的广泛领域,为数学研究与教育提供革命性工具。
一、技术突破:重新定义数学证明的边界
DeepSeek MathProver基于改进的Transformer架构,通过引入符号计算注意力机制(Symbolic Computation Attention, SCA)和分层证明树生成(Hierarchical Proof Tree Generation, HPTG)技术,实现了对数学符号系统的深度解析。模型在训练阶段采用多模态数据融合策略,同时处理LaTeX公式、自然语言描述和半形式化证明,构建了包含12亿个数学逻辑单元的庞大知识库。
在核心算法层面,MathProver创新性地将蒙特卡洛树搜索(MCTS)与反向链式推理(Backward Chaining)结合,形成动态证明路径优化系统。例如在处理费马小定理证明时,模型通过概率评估选择最优的归纳假设起点,相比传统定理证明器(如Lean、Coq)减少67%的中间步骤。实测数据显示,模型在集合论证明任务中达到98.7%的准确率,在群论证明中突破92%的复杂命题覆盖率。
二、开源生态:构建数学研究的协同网络
DeepSeek以Apache 2.0协议开放模型权重与训练代码,配套发布数学证明可视化工具包(MPV Toolkit),支持将证明过程转换为交互式图形界面。开发者可通过简单的Python接口调用模型:
from deepseek_mathprover import MathProverprover = MathProver(precision="high")proof = prover.generate_proof(theorem="∀n∈ℕ, n² + n ≡ 0 (mod 2)",method="induction",max_steps=50)print(proof.to_latex())
社区已涌现出多个衍生项目,包括定理证明协作平台(ProofHub)、数学竞赛自动解题系统(MathOlympiad AI)等。值得注意的是,某高校团队利用MathProver重构了《数学分析》教材中的217个定理证明,发现13处传统证明中的冗余步骤,相关成果已被《美国数学月刊》接收。
三、应用场景:从理论到实践的跨越
教育领域革新
模型内置的渐进式证明引导功能,可根据学生知识水平动态调整证明难度。例如在讲解微积分中值定理时,系统会先生成基于几何直观的简化证明,再逐步引入ε-δ语言。测试显示,使用该功能的学生在定理理解测试中得分提升41%。科研加速
在代数几何领域,MathProver协助某研究组在72小时内完成了关于Calabi-Yau流形的12个新命题验证,而传统方法需要数周时间。模型特别擅长处理组合爆炸问题,通过剪枝算法将可能的证明路径从10^18种缩减至可控范围。工业应用
某芯片设计公司利用模型验证硬件描述语言(HDL)中的时序约束,发现传统人工审查遗漏的3处竞争冒险(Race Hazard)。模型生成的证明报告可直接转换为形式化验证脚本,使验证周期缩短60%。
四、技术挑战与未来方向
尽管MathProver在标准化测试中表现优异,但在处理非构造性证明(如存在性证明)时仍存在局限。研究团队正在开发反例生成模块,通过构造性否定提升模型对证明必要性的理解。此外,量子计算与定理证明的结合研究已提上日程,初步实验显示量子注意力机制可提升证明效率15-20%。
对于开发者社区,建议从以下方向切入:
- 构建特定数学领域的微调模型(如数论、概率论)
- 开发证明过程解释性工具,增强人类可读性
- 探索与交互式定理证明器(ITP)的混合架构
DeepSeek MathProver的发布标志着数学证明从手工时代向智能时代的跨越。其开源特性不仅降低了研究门槛,更通过社区协作不断拓展数学自动化的边界。正如国际数学联盟主席评价:”这可能是自计算机代数系统诞生以来,数学研究范式最重要的变革。”

发表评论
登录后可评论,请前往 登录 或 注册